Police have made an urgent appeal for information after a “heinous” sexual assault on a seven-year-old Perth girl in her own bed on Boxing Day.

Child Abuse Squad detectives are investigating the incident, which allegedly took place between 8pm on Sunday and 9am on Monday at the young girl’s home in Ellenbrook, about 30km north-east of Perth.

WA Police Sex Crime Division Inspector Hamish McKenzie told reporters on Tuesday the little girl went to bed on Sunday and woke to tell her father, who then reported the alleged assault to police.

He said police believe a male offender unknown to the victim entered the house in that period.

Mounted police, forensic officers and drone operators are currently searching an area of Ellenbrook between Tonkin Highway, The Broadway and The Promenade for items that may assist the investigation, including a white window fly screen and a girl’s blue pyjama top that are missing from the home.

Insp McKenzie said police believed the top — which depicts a festive gingerbread man and the slogan “oh snap” — was taken from the family home, but did not confirm whether the little girl was wearing it when she went to bed.



Anyone with information is encouraged to contact Crime Stoppers on 1800 333 000 or make a report online.

Charges include burglary.
The Court case has been moved to the District Court - January 27, 2022.
Broke in through a bathroom window.

Might end up having some similarities with the recent near Carnarvon WA, Blowholes 4yo camping case, if they are both proven to have started out as a burglary.

'Police have revealed that Mr Davies, 25, handed himself in shortly after they released CCTV vision on Wednesday of a man climbing over the wall of a neighbour’s house and into the backyard near the girl’s home where the assault took place.'

'On Friday, Police Minister Paul Papalia said detectives were close to tracking down Mr Davies before he turned himself in.'

'Police allege that Mr Davies broke into the girl’s home through the bathroom window about 12.30am on Monday and sexually assaulted her in her bed while her parents and sibling slept in rooms nearby.'

'Insp. Hamish McKenzie said ... it was not believed that the accused predator targeted the girl or her family, despite living nearby.'

'Mr Davies faces charges of sexual penetration of a child aged 13 or younger, indecent dealings with a child aged 13 or younger, deprivation of liberty, impeding a person’s normal breathing by blocking their nose or mouth, impeding a person’s normal breathing or blood circulation by applying pressure to their neck and aggravated home burglary.

He is due back in Midland Magistrates Court on January 27, with a police prosecutor saying the charges against Mr Davie were “indictable offences” and would be moved up to the District Court.'

'A conviction for sexual penetration of a child carries a minimum 15-year jail term when committed during an aggravated home burglary.'
